The number 42’s primary meaning comes from Douglas Adams’ The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y, where it’s the “Answer to the Ultimate Question of Life, the Universe, and Everything,” a humorous, symbolic answer implying the question itself is more important. Beyond the book, it appears in science fiction, coding (ASCII asterisk), and even religious texts (Kabbalah, Revelation), often as a pop culture reference for a mysterious or simple answer, or to signify that meaning is subjective.
From The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y
The Answer: A supercomputer, Deep Thought, calculates 42 after 7.5 million years, but the creators never knew the Ultimate Question.
Symbolism: It represents the absurdity of seeking a single, simple answer to complex existence, or that meaning is what we make it.
Other contexts
Pop Culture/Tech: Used as a nod to Adams in programming (ASCII * is 42, meaning “anything”), movies, and online culture as a placeholder for a simple, funny, or ultimate answer.
Religion/Mysticism: In Kabbalah, it relates to the Forty-Two-Lettered Name of God. In Revelation, 42 months symbolizes conflict.
Mathematics: It’s a sphenic number (product of three distinct primes: 2x3x7) and has other properties, but its fame is largely cultural.
Overall meaning
While it has roots in specific cultures, 42 has become a widespread meme, symbolizing the search for meaning, the unknowable, or a playfully random answer.

The Answer to the Ultimate Question of Life, the Universe and Everything
Date: Wed, Apr 7, 2021
Location: Zoom, Online
Conference: PIMS Network Wide Colloquium
Subject: Mathematics, Physics
Class: Scientific
Abstract:
In The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y, by Douglas Adams, the number 42 was revealed to be the “Answer to the Ultimate Question of Life, the Universe, and Everything”. But he didn’t say what the question was! I will reveal that here. In fact it is a simple geometry question, which then turns out to be related to the mathematics underlying string theory.
Speaker Biography
John Baez is a leader in the area of mathematical physics at the interface between quantum field theory and category theory, and has broad interests in mathematics, and science more generally. He created one of the earliest blogs “This week’s finds in Mathematical Physics” (before the term blog existed!)
Baez did his PhD at MIT, and was a Gibbs Instructor at Yale before moving to University of California, Riverside in 1988.
